2X is seeking a visionary senior executive to lead our GTM Engineering & Orchestration Services —the fastest growing group within 2X, with 400+ professionals across the U.S., Kuala Lumpur, and Manila, with a goal to scale beyond 1,000 by 2028.

As the Global Leader , you’ll own the strategy, growth, and operational excellence of our GTM Engineering & Orchestration practice, providing B2B marketing transformation for leading global brands. This role blends strategist, operator, product leader, and mentor - responsible for driving client impact, scaling internal capabilities, and strengthening 2X’s differentiation in the marketplace.


You’ll unify five interconnected sub-practices:

  • RevOps Strategy: Elevating and evolving clients’ GTM architecture and tech stacks.
  • RevTech Services: Partnering with leading platforms like 6sense, Gong and others.
  • RevOps Services: Operating GTM platforms such as HubSpot, Salesforce, and Adobe.
  • Data & Analytics Operations: Powering data-driven insights and performance tracking to strengthen decision making capabilities.
  • Work Management: Building world-class marketing operations workflows on Asana, Monday.com and more.
